Abstract:
Covered footbridge consists of two identical symmetrical double cantilevers built one after the other. Structure is 8 in. (20 cm) thick folded slab system made up of roof slab and triangular side walls with post-tensioning tendons in the roof slab. Walkway panels are precast and suspended from superstructure.
